ホームページ > ウェブフロントエンド > jsチュートリアル > JavaScript はどのようにして AJAX 呼び出しの URL パラメーターを動的に操作できるのでしょうか?

JavaScript はどのようにして AJAX 呼び出しの URL パラメーターを動的に操作できるのでしょうか?

Susan Sarandon
リリース: 2024-12-02 08:30:14
オリジナル
635 人が閲覧しました

How Can JavaScript Dynamically Manipulate URL Parameters for AJAX Calls?

JavaScript を使用した URL パラメーターの動的操作

Web アプリケーションで AJAX 呼び出しを実装する場合、URL 内のパラメーターを追加または変更することが必要になることがよくあります。 。たとえば、元の URL「http://server/myapp.php?id=10」の末尾に「&enabled=true」を追加したい場合、JavaScript はこれを動的に実現するソリューションを提供します。

URL API の利用

最新のブラウザで利用できる URL API は、URL を解析および変更するための強力なツールを提供します。以下に例を示します。

var url = new URL("http://server/myapp.php?id=10");

// Append or update parameter
url.searchParams.append("enabled", "true"); // Appends "&enabled=true"

// Get the modified URL
var modifiedUrl = url.href;
ログイン後にコピー

URLSearchParams の活用

URLSearchParams は、URL パラメータを管理するための特定の機能を提供する JavaScript オブジェクトです。使用方法は次のとおりです。

var params = new URLSearchParams(window.location.search);

// Add or update parameter
params.append("enabled", "true");

// Create a new URL with the updated parameters
var modifiedUrl = window.location.pathname + "?" + params.toString();
ログイン後にコピー

URL API と URLSearchParams はどちらも、URL パラメーターを動的に追加または変更するための便利なメソッドを提供します。これらのソリューションにより、開発者は特定の要件に合わせた URL を構築できるようになり、AJAX 呼び出し中のシームレスかつ効率的なデータ取得が保証されます。

以上がJavaScript はどのようにして AJAX 呼び出しの URL パラメーターを動的に操作できるのでしょうか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
著者別の最新記事
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ート